Republic of the Congo visa for Burkinabé citizens

For citizens of Burkina Faso planning a visit to the Republic of the Congo, your journey is streamlined by the availability of a visa on arrival. This convenient option typically grants a stay of up to 30 days for tourist purposes, obtainable upon payment of approximately XOF 50,000 at entry points like Brazzaville's Maya-Maya Airport, facilitating one of the two available "Tourist" visa types. Connecting flights often involve a stopover in a regional hub such as Lomé or Addis Ababa, bridging the significant distance between West and Central Africa. While both nations utilize the CFA Franc, travelers should be mindful of the distinction between the WAEMU and CEMAC zones when managing currency, a unique consideration for this specific inter-regional journey.
